Todays vast amount of knowledge including Geology defines some functions as to why Allah(God) created mountains and hills on Earth, these functions were foretold by the Holy Quran over 1400 years ago;

In the name of Allah most gracious most merciful

And We have placed in the Earth firm hills lest it quake with them .

Allah indeed speaks the truth

REFERENCE: Chapter (The Prophets) part of verse "31"